1/3 Why do I see FMTUSER CO debits on my account statement?
FMTUSER CO card transactions are the consequence of a subscription to an online service. In other words, FMTUSER CO charges you because you have subscribed to a website that offers a service (contests? Refund/discount sites? Dating sites, films/series, video games, clairvoyance, etc.) there are thousands of sites that offer offers on the subscription model).
By subscribing, you have given permission to the company linked to FMTUSER CO to charge you each month. A bit like a SEPA direct debit, but directly via your bank card.
But I never agreed to subscribe to anything and pay every month! We believe you. Many Internet users share this reaction! Here is what could have happened: you entered your card numbers to make a small online purchase (trial offer, shipping costs for a gift, etc.) and you have not read the Site Conditions (GTC ) which indicated that unless you decline it, you are subscribing to their service. Result: there is an active subscription linked to your card.

3/3 Legal or fraud FMTUSER CO: what does the law say?
Is FMTUSER CO a scam? : some believe it is fraud, others consider it legal. In March 2018, the Court of Cassation upheld the culpable negligence of a customer who had transmitted his bank details to a fraudulent site. The bank had opposed his requests for reimbursement, accusing him of negligence in the custody and conservation of his personal data of the security system of payment instruments.
The bank can therefore rely on this court decision to refuse to block your card and / or problematic withdrawals.
If you are still in possession of your bank card, there is little chance (or rather risk) that it is a hack on the part of FMTUSER CO as explained above: blocking the card would therefore as a consequence of not honoring a contract for which you signed up (by validating the General Conditions of Sale). We therefore do not recommend blocking your credit card but carrying out the online procedures to cancel the current subscription.
